UltraWideo

It manipulates video aspect ratio to fit your entire screen.

2 followers

This extension is primarily for UltraWide monitors, but that does not mean it's only good for it. You can manipulate the size of the video that contains horizontal or vertical black bars and let the video fill your entire screen for a better experience.

UltraWideo 2.0

Cross-browser extension that manipulates video aspect ratio.
Cross-browser extension that works in all browsers (except Safari).
It manipulates the aspect ratio of the video the currently watched video that is in full-screen. Enjoy the better experience on all screens, especially on UltraWide ones.

I've really considered switching to an ultrawide monitor at some point. I'll have to remember this if I ever do. @dvlden What are the benefits for non-ultrawide users?
Nenad Novaković
@jakecrump Thank you for your comment. I'm also using this extension on my Macbook Pro, both 15" and 13" and it helps when using the Upscale mode to remove the minor vertical black bars that can be present on some videos. That said, it helps with both vertical and horizontal black bars. And people using it on Firefox Android are giving nice feedback, saying that it solves some bug with videos. I don't have an android, nor it was intentional to make some kind of fix, but I'm happy that it magically happened.
